Technical Field

[0001] The utility model relates to the technical field of power isolation knives, in particular to an isolation knife switch. Background Art

[0002] In power systems, an isolating switch (also known as a disconnector) is a manually operated electrical device without an arc extinguishing device. It is primarily used to isolate circuits to ensure the safety of maintenance personnel or operators. Isolating switches are widely used in power systems of various voltage levels, such as power plants and substations. During maintenance or equipment replacement, operating an isolating switch ensures that the equipment being repaired is de-energized, thereby ensuring the safety of personnel.

[0003] The current isolation knife switch mainly includes two conductive seats and a connecting blade. One end of the connecting blade is hinged to one of the conductive seats. The two conductive seats are connected or disconnected by rotating the connecting blade. However, the current isolation knife switch requires a large operating radius when in use. For some compact box-type transformers with limited space in the low-voltage side cabinet, this type of isolation knife switch cannot be used. Utility Model Content

[0004] The purpose of the utility model is to solve the problem that the isolation knife switch in the box with limited space cannot be used, and to provide an isolation knife switch.

[0005] In order to achieve the above-mentioned purpose, the solution adopted by the utility model is: an isolating knife switch, including a first conductive seat and a second conductive seat, a socket is provided on the first conductive seat, and a pin is provided on the second conductive seat. The pin can slide on the second conductive seat, and a driving mechanism for driving the pin to slide is also connected to the pin. The operation of the driving mechanism can drive the pin to insert into or detach from the socket.

[0006] Through the above technical solution, the driving mechanism drives the pin to move and insert into the socket, thereby realizing the connection between the first conductive seat and the second conductive seat, and changing the traditional rotating connection of the connecting blade into a mobile connection, thereby reducing the required operating space and being suitable for use in confined spaces.

[0007] As a preferred embodiment of the present invention, a guide block is provided inside the second conductive seat, and a sliding groove distributed along the axial direction is provided on the outer wall of the pin, and the guide block is provided in the sliding groove.

[0008] According to the above technical solution, by providing the slide groove and the guide block, the pin can move along the direction of the guide block through the slide groove.

[0009] As a preferred embodiment of the present invention, the driving mechanism includes a screw rod, a nut seat, a transmission shaft and a handwheel. The nut seat is arranged in the pin, the screw rod is cooperatively connected to the nut seat, and the handwheel is connected to the screw rod through the transmission shaft. The rotation of the handwheel drives the screw rod to rotate.

[0010] Through the above technical solution, the driving mechanism adopts the screw nut method for transmission, and the screw is driven to rotate by rotating the handwheel, thereby driving the nut seat and the pin to move, thereby realizing the linear movement of the pin.

[0011] As a preferred embodiment of the present invention, a clamping block is further provided on the outer wall of the nut seat, and a clamping groove matching the clamping block is provided on the inner wall of the pin. The clamping block is provided in the clamping groove to limit the rotation between the nut seat and the pin.

[0012] Through the above technical solution, the groove provided on the pin cooperates with the block on the nut seat to limit the rotation of the nut seat, so that the rotation of the screw rod can be converted into the movement of the nut seat.

[0013] As a preferred embodiment of the present invention, the nut seat is arranged at an end of the pin away from the first conductive seat, and an axial limiting mechanism for limiting the axial movement of the nut seat is also provided in the pin.

[0014] Through the above technical solution, the nut seat can be inserted into the interior of the pin from one end of the pin and limited by the axial limiting mechanism, so that the nut seat drives the pin to move synchronously when moving.

[0015] As a preferred embodiment of the present invention, a flange bearing seat is further included, the transmission shaft is cooperatively connected to the flange bearing seat, one end of the transmission shaft is connected to the screw rod, and the other end is connected to the handwheel.

[0016] Through the above technical solution, the flange bearing seat is fixed to the insulating shell, which facilitates subsequent operation and use.

[0017] As a preferred embodiment of the present invention, a mounting groove is provided on the inner wall of the sleeve, and a contact spring is provided in the mounting groove.

[0018] With the above technical solution, by providing a mounting groove on the inner wall of the socket and providing a contact spring in the mounting groove, when the pin is inserted into the socket, it can always be ensured that the pin and the socket remain connected.

[0019] As a preferred embodiment of the present invention, a mounting groove is provided on the inner wall of the second conductive seat, and a contact spring is provided in the mounting groove.

[0020] According to the above technical solution, by arranging a mounting groove on the inner wall of the second conductive seat and arranging a contact spring in the mounting groove, it can be ensured that the pin is always connected to the second conductive seat.

[0021] In summary, the present invention has at least one of the following beneficial technical effects:

[0022] 1. This utility model changes the traditional rotating connection of the connecting blade into a movable connection of the pin, which significantly reduces the space required for operation. It provides a more practical choice for occasions with limited space, such as compact box-type low-voltage side cabinets, making operation more convenient while ensuring the safety and reliability of the equipment in a small space.

[0023] 2. This utility provides mounting grooves on the inner walls of the pin and socket, and contains contact springs. Whether inserting or removing the pin, the contact springs ensure good electrical contact between the pin, socket, and second conductive base. This not only enhances electrical conductivity but also reduces safety hazards caused by poor contact.

[0024] 3. By setting a slide groove on the pin and matching it with the guide block inside the second conductive seat, the straightness of the pin during the sliding process is ensured, avoiding electrical connection failures caused by pin deviation, and further improving the service life and safety of the product. DETAILED DESCRIPTION

[0029] The following is combined with Figure 1-3 The utility model is described in further detail.

[0030] Reference Figures 1 to 3This embodiment discloses an isolating knife switch, comprising a first conductive base 1 and a second conductive base 2, both of which are made of conductive materials. A socket is disposed on the first conductive base 1, and a connection portion 9 is also disposed at one end of the first conductive base 1. A mounting groove 16 is disposed on the inner wall of the socket, and an annular contact spring 13 is disposed within the mounting groove 16. In this embodiment, two annular mounting grooves 16 are disposed on the inner wall of the socket, each of which contains a contact spring 13.

[0031] The second conductive portion 2 is a three-way structure, with a pin 3 positioned within the left end of the tee. In this embodiment, the pin 3 is a hollow cylindrical conductor. A slot 8 is provided on the outer wall of the pin 3, extending along its axial direction. A guide block 17 is positioned within the left end of the tee. In this embodiment, a fixing screw hole 10 is provided at the left end of the second conductive portion 2. The guide block 17 is secured to the inner wall of the second conductive portion 2 by inserting a screw through the fixing screw hole 10. The guide block 17 is positioned within the slot 8, allowing the pin 3 to slide within the second conductive base 2. To ensure good contact between the pin 3 and the second conductive base 2 and ensure good electrical stability, two annular mounting grooves 16 are provided within the inner wall of the second conductive portion 2, specifically the inner wall of the left end of the tee. Each mounting groove 16 contains a contact spring 13.

[0032] The lower end of the second conductive part 2 is provided with a wire connection part 11 for connecting a conductor. The right end of the second conductive part 2 is provided with a driving mechanism for driving the pin 3 to slide. The driving mechanism can drive the pin 3 to insert into or remove from the socket.

[0033] In this embodiment, the driving mechanism includes a screw rod 4 , a nut seat 12 , a transmission shaft 7 , a flange bearing seat 5 and a handwheel 6 .

[0034] A nut seat 12 is disposed within the pin 3. Specifically, the nut seat 12 is disposed at the end of the pin 3 away from the first conductive seat 1. An axial limit mechanism is also disposed within the pin 3 to restrict axial movement of the nut seat 12. A clamping block 15 is also disposed on the outer wall of the nut seat 12. A slot 14 is disposed on the inner wall of the pin 3 to engage with the clamping block 15. The clamping block 15 is disposed within the slot 14 to restrict rotation between the nut seat 12 and the pin 3.

[0035] The screw rod 4 is coupled to the nut seat 12, and the handwheel 6 is coupled to the screw rod 4 via a transmission shaft 7. Rotation of the handwheel 6 drives the screw rod 4. The transmission shaft 7 is coupled to the flange bearing seat 5. In this embodiment, the flange bearing seat 5 is fixed to the insulating box. The flange bearing seat 5 includes two bearings. One end of the transmission shaft 7 is coupled to the screw rod 4, and the other end is coupled to the handwheel 6. The handwheel 6 is disposed outside the insulating box.

[0036] The working principle of the isolation knife switch provided in this embodiment is as follows:

[0037] When it is necessary to connect the first conductive seat 1 and the second conductive seat 2, the hand wheel 6 is rotated clockwise, and the screw rod 4 is driven to rotate clockwise through the transmission shaft 7. The screw rod 4 rotates clockwise, driving the nut seat 12 and the pin 3 to move along the guide block 17 toward the first conductive seat 1. As the screw rod 4 rotates, the pin 3 is gradually inserted into the plug, thereby completing the connection between the first conductive seat 1 and the second conductive seat 2.

[0038] When it is necessary to disconnect the electrical connection between the first conductive seat 1 and the second conductive seat 2, the hand wheel 6 is rotated counterclockwise, and the screw rod 4 is driven to rotate counterclockwise through the transmission shaft 7. The screw rod 4 rotates counterclockwise, driving the nut seat 12 and the pin 3 to move along the guide block 17 away from the first conductive seat 1. As the screw rod 4 rotates, the pin 3 gradually disengages from the socket of the first conductive seat 1, thereby disconnecting the electrical connection between the first conductive seat 1 and the second conductive seat 2.
